In this recipe each spinach leaf is dipped in a spiced chickpea flour (gram flour) batter and then fried. The result is a crisp and golden gram flour batter coated spinach fritters that taste awesome with a cup of tea and some green chutney. Palak pakoda, these crispy spinach fritters are perfect afternoon snack to serve in the rainy season. The process of making pakoda at home is very easy and requires a few basic ingredients like spinach and gram flour (besan).

The ingredients needed to make Palak (spinach) Pakoda/ Fritters:
  1. Take 1 bunch spinach
  2. Take 1 cup besan (gram flour)
  3. Prepare 1 tsp red chilli powder
  4. Get 1/2 tsp turmeric powder
  5. Prepare to taste salt
  6. Get pinch asafoetida
  7. Take 1/4 tsp Amchur powder
  8. Prepare pinch carom seeds
  9. Make ready as required water
  10. Take as required Oil for frying

Steps to make Palak (spinach) Pakoda/ Fritters:
  1. Wash and clean the spinach, roughly chop it and keep aside.
  2. Mix all the dry ingredients and adding small quantities of water and make thick smooth batter.
  3. Heat oil in a deep pan, keep the heat medium-high flame.
  4. Slowly coat chopped spinach with the mixture and carefully drop it in the pan. Fry till golden brown. Remove and place it on a paper towel to drain excess oil.
  5. Spinach pakoda is ready to be served.
